Can I tip with USD in Egypt?

I used to recommend tipping in local currency (Egyptian Pounds), but recently, with all of the challenges Egypt has had in obtaining foreign currency, tipping in US Dollars or Euros is now the preferred method for most people to receive tips.

Is it best to take cash to Egypt?

It's always advisable to bring money in a variety of forms on a vacation: a mix of cash, credit cards, and traveler's checks. American and Canadian dollars, pounds sterling, and euros are all easily exchanged in Egypt, and Cairo International Airport has a number of 24-hour banks that give the same rates as in town.

How much do you tip a driver and guide in Egypt?

The standard tip percentage for tour guides is around 10-15% of the total cost of the tour. For drivers, it's recommended to tip about 5-10% of the total cost of the tour, depending on the level of service. Taxis: When taking a taxi in Egypt, it's recommended to tip the driver around 10-15% of the total fare.

How much do you tip a bathroom attendant in Egypt?

between 1 – 2LEIf you are visiting a spa in Egypt prepare to tip between 10 – 15% of your total bill for the staff. Bathroom attendants are common in Egypt and you can tip them between 1 – 2LE. If you take a Felucca ride in Egypt tip the captain around 5 – 10LE.
